JOB TITLE:

Plant Manager 

The Plant Manager is responsible for the safety, quality, and productivity of the Blaze/Cafco blending operations. This position manages the daily activities of employees to achieve the company’s goals and objectives. This position is also responsible for ensuring that the facility meets expectations for production scheduling, inventory control, operating rate, and facility financial performance. The Plant Manager leads by proactively resolving employee issues, building teamwork, and ensuring adherence to all applicable company policies and procedures in a fair and consistent manner.

ESSENTIAL DUTIES AND RESPONSIBILITIES

Provide effective, positive leadership to motivate a team of hourly production employees

 Ensure all EHS programs are followed and drive the plant team to cultural improvement where no employees get hurt.

Plan, direct and coordinate the manufacturing of products in compliance with company goals and objectives.  Take leadership of plant operating daily metrics and MDI (managing for daily improvements) program.

Ability to analyze safety, quality and productivity issues and take corrective measures.

Make sure that inventory levels are accurate.

As required, lead the identification and set-up of various processing equipment.

Promptly and accurately complete all record keeping assignments.

Maintain a clean, safe and well-organized department.

Ability to multi-task while dealing with multiple, competing priorities.

Coach employees for attainment of company and individual goals and objectives in accordance with Company guidelines and performance management system.

Drive Continuous Improvement Projects, through analytical processes, strategic planning, critical evaluation and precise communications.  

Other duties as assigned by Regional Operations Manager

SCOPE OF POSITION

The position reports to the Regional Operations Manager.  Develop and improve plant performance including safety/EHS, cost reduction, waste minimization and shift/equipment operation and optimization.   Provide after-hours support as needed.   

MINIMUM JOB REQUIREMENTS

EXPERIENCE:

Bachelor’s degree in technical field (engineering preferred) and 5 years of production management experience or Associates Degree and 10 years of Production Management experience.  

KNOWLEDGE:

Powder blending operations and packaging experience preferred, but not required.  Production scheduling and process optimization.

SKILLS:

Microsoft software (Microsoft Word, Excel, and PowerPoint), is required.  Proficient use of the Excel data analytics package preferred. Ability to work under minimum supervision. Ability to multi-task. Ability to effectively present information and respond to questions during group meetings, happenings, etc.
